We are looking for a developer to create a new desktop application that will provide analytical tools to assist in the pricing of a product or service. Users will enter a small amount of data covering competitors, potential price points, expected customer reactions to potential prices, and costs. The application will analyze the input data to determine the prices that maximize profits, revenues, or other target variables. The analysis will include fitting curves to small data sets and finding maximum points on fitted curves. Users will be able to see the results both plotted on graphs and summarized in tables.
